The Challenge
A leading financial institution was facing a culture disconnect. Following the appointment of a new CEO and the acquisition of several banks, team members found it challenging to connect with leadership. Many employees could not name their CEO, internal communications felt outdated, and engagement across the organization was low. With minimal creative resources, no added headcount, and skepticism about change, the firm needed a new approach to executive visibility and cultural alignment.
The Approach
We designed and implemented a comprehensive leadership visibility strategy that humanized executives and built trust across the workforce. Key initiatives included:
Establishing an in-house creative function to deliver modern, campaign-style communications.
Launching a social media-inspired intranet platform for internal content distribution.
Spearheading a CEO-led podcast and implementing video storytelling to showcase leaders’ authentic perspectives.
Transforming quarterly meetings into high-production events that felt dynamic and inspiring.
Authoring the company’s employer value proposition and designing creative for talent recruitment, DEI programs, and leadership development.
Partnering with HR and Learning & Development to reintroduce leadership programs and create meaningful employee experiences, such as Team Appreciation Week.
Leading the CEO’s first leadership conference, including scripting, stage design, branding, and production management.
The Results
The leadership visibility program delivered a measurable cultural shift:
CEO approval rating rose from 60% to 84%.
Employee engagement increased to 84%, confirmed by a companywide survey with a 67% response rate.
The company became certified as a Great Place to Work, with 86% positive reviews.
The talent pipeline grew 150%, supporting recruitment and retention efforts.
The firm received a Future Comms award for intranet adoption and a Human Capital Management Excellence Award for leadership program design.
More than 1,000 integrated campaigns were executed in just four years, blending internal and external communications into one cohesive narrative.
Why It Matters
This case demonstrates how strategic storytelling and executive visibility can repair cultural disconnects, foster transparency, and strengthen trust between leadership and employees. By combining modern tools with authentic communication, we helped create an environment where leadership felt accessible and employees felt engaged in the company vision.
